Transaction 35903557664070fbd053c1c41b3602cabef872b8a33ba55426a13b08307d467d
1 Input
1 Output
-
35903557664070fbd053c1c41b3602cabef872b8a33ba55426a13b08307d467d:0
- value
- 2604167
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c0ba56b71bd9521d7916c6f88bd67d79df7dba0 OP_EQUAL
- address
- 3QfiA5K3nSaBaGuvurQJfCacyZ8PRYXbTW